To quote Annie herself "There's no need for tedious priming and sanding you can get directly to the enjoyable bit!" The Annie Sloan chalk paint system really consists of two parts: the chalk paint, and a protective wax top coat that's applied after the paint dries (you can pick to utilize either a clear wax or a dark wax).
